Soft drink companies like Coca-Cola Japan are responding to the buying preferences of an aging population and a general greater focus on health and fitness. The new 5-Grain Tea illustrates the swing from sweet, sugary "junk drinks" to more healthy - but still tasty - tonics.

In New Zealand, a series of artistic ads were created for a local coffee company. Ten artists created 30 pieces of art - all made using coffee napkins. The ads were displayed in bus shelters along an Auckland Street. The effect was a series of mini art galleries to promote coffee.
